SIMHEAT® is a simulation software dedicated to heat treatment processes applied either in the volume or on the surface. It can be used to model heat treatments of a large variety of materials such as low alloy steel, stainless steel, aluminum, or titanium. It is an effective solution to predict phase transformations, product’s hardness, tensile strength and to obtain residual stresses and microstructure evolution during and after heat treatment.
